diff --git a/ch2/ch2-03-1.md b/ch2/ch2-03-1.md
index 72656c3..456cda5 100644
--- a/ch2/ch2-03-1.md
+++ b/ch2/ch2-03-1.md
@@ -61,6 +61,6 @@ f, err := os.Open(infile)
 f, err := os.Create(outfile) // compile error: no new variables
 ```

-解决的方法是第二个简短变量声明语句改用普通的多重赋值语言。
+解决的方法是第二个简短变量声明语句改用普通的多重赋值语句。

 简短变量声明语句只有对已经在同级词法域声明过的变量才和赋值操作语句等价,如果变量是在外部词法域声明的,那么简短变量声明语句将会在当前词法域重新声明一个新的变量。我们在本章后面将会看到类似的例子。
This commit is contained in:
Xargin 2017-07-31 12:47:55 +08:00
parent 085771255c
commit 80ad3eea47

View File

@ -61,6 +61,6 @@ f, err := os.Open(infile)
f, err := os.Create(outfile) // compile error: no new variables f, err := os.Create(outfile) // compile error: no new variables
``` ```
解决的方法是第二个简短变量声明语句改用普通的多重赋值语 解决的方法是第二个简短变量声明语句改用普通的多重赋值语
简短变量声明语句只有对已经在同级词法域声明过的变量才和赋值操作语句等价,如果变量是在外部词法域声明的,那么简短变量声明语句将会在当前词法域重新声明一个新的变量。我们在本章后面将会看到类似的例子。 简短变量声明语句只有对已经在同级词法域声明过的变量才和赋值操作语句等价,如果变量是在外部词法域声明的,那么简短变量声明语句将会在当前词法域重新声明一个新的变量。我们在本章后面将会看到类似的例子。